Why Healthcare Data Quality Matters Now More Than Ever
For years, the healthcare industry has struggled with fragmented, inconsistent, and inaccurate data. This impacts everything from clinical decision support to population health management. Recent research from Gartner (november 2023) estimates that poor data quality costs organizations an average of $12.9 million annually. This isn’t just a financial burden; it directly affects patient outcomes and erodes trust. Improving healthcare data integrity is no longer optional – it’s essential.
Key challenges contributing to poor data quality include:
* Data Silos: Details locked within disparate systems that don’t communicate.
* Lack of Standardization: Variations in terminology, coding, and data formats.Think about different ways to record allergies or medications.
* Human Error: Mistakes during data entry and manual processes.
* Legacy Systems: Outdated infrastructure unable to handle modern data demands.
* Interoperability Issues: Difficulty exchanging data between different healthcare providers and systems. This impacts health information exchange significantly.

Introducing the Patient Information Quality Betterment Framework (PIQI)
A groundbreaking initiative is the Patient Information Quality Improvement Framework (PIQI).This open-source collaboration, involving partners like the VA and CMS, provides a standardized way to measure and improve data quality across the industry. PIQI isn’t about blaming individuals; it’s about identifying systemic issues and implementing solutions.
PIQI focuses on key dimensions of data quality:
* Accuracy: Is the data correct?
* Completeness: Is all necessary data present?
* Consistency: Is the data uniform across systems?
* Timeliness: Is the data up-to-date?
* Validity: Dose the data conform to defined standards?
By consistently assessing these dimensions, healthcare organizations can pinpoint areas for improvement and track progress over time. This is crucial for building trust in clinical data management.
Actionable Steps You Can Take:
- Data Governance: establish clear policies and procedures for data management.
- Data Standardization: Adopt standardized terminologies and coding systems (e.g., SNOMED CT, LOINC).
- Data Validation: Implement automated checks to identify and correct errors.
- Data Cleansing: Regularly review and update existing data to ensure accuracy.
- Invest in Interoperability: Prioritize systems that can seamlessly exchange data. Consider FHIR standards for improved data exchange.
